Planning effective AV and production setups
Start by documenting technical requirements for speakers, presentations, lighting, and streaming needs. Clear specs allow vendors to provide accurate proposals and reduce last-minute technical problems.
AV planning steps:
- Create a detailed tech rider specifying mic types, stage dimensions, screen sizes, and connectivity.
- Schedule load‑in and tech rehearsals well before doors open.
- Confirm backup equipment and contingency plans (spare mics, cables, adapters).
Coordination tips:
- Provide the production team with a run-of-show that lists cues, timestamps, and contacts.
- Test wireless networks and streaming bandwidth if broadcasting or using apps.
- Assign an on-site AV lead who knows the plan and can troubleshoot quickly.
Reliable AV depends on clear requirements, rehearsals, and backups. Investing in experienced technicians and adequate rehearsal time prevents most production issues.
